The Herd of Ice Age

The Herd initially comprised the oddball trio of Manny, the mammoth, Diego, the saber-toothed tiger, and Sid, the sloth. As the story progressed, their brood grew to an ever-expanding, extremely weird, yet happy family.

Manny

Voiced by Ray Romano

“I’m not fat. It’s all this fur. It makes me look… poofy.”

Manfred or Manny, as he’s better known as, is a woolly mammoth. He along with his two buddies Diego and Sid are the main protagonists of the Ice Age franchise.

Kind and rather lovable, Manny is someone who epitomizes the term ‘gentle giant’. Manny’s heart belongs to his quirky brood and is prone to go the whole nine yards to keep them out of trouble.

Trivia

In the movie, Manny is referred to by several names including Manfred, that neeny weeny mammoth, Manny the Moody Mammoth, Manny the Melancholy, Jumbo, the mammoth, Fat Hair Boy, and buddy.

Diego

Voiced by Denis Leary

“Excuse me? I happen to be a remorseless assassin.”

Diego is the too-cool-for-school saber-toothed tiger who joins Manny’s herd with devious intentions, but goes on to become an inseparable part of it. Killer instincts come naturally to him, especially when dealing with Sid, but his loyalty towards his friends tends to take over.

Almost always.

Trivia

While both Manny and Sid have been shown to have their respective love interests throughout the series, Diego got his female lead only in the 4th installment.

Sid

Voiced by John Leguizamo

“From now on, you’ll have to refer to me as “Sid, Lord of the Flame.”

From being abandoned by his own family to raising dinosaur babies, Sid, the wisecracking sloth, has done it all throughout the course of the series.

Goofy, smelly, unhygienic, yet immensely lovable, Sid is often the butt of jokes in the herd.

Trivia

John Leguizamo actually demonstrated 30 different voices for Sid. After researching about sloths, he discovered that they store food in their mouths, which gave him an idea to speak with food in his mouth. And, this came to be the perfect voice for Sid.

Scrat

Voiced by Chris Wedge

The acorn-obssessed Scrat is a saber-toothed squirrel, whose purpose of existence is to find a safe stowaway for his beloved acorn.

Yes, he’s rejected female advances and even played a role in the sinking of “Scratlantis”. Scrat is not a part of the Herd, but has had interactions with them every now and then. His track moves along that of the film, albeit independently.

Trivia

The name Scrat is a supposed portmanteau of ‘squirrel’ and ‘rat’. The character is voiced by director Chris Wedge who is also one of the directors of the franchise.

Ice Age: The Meltdown (2006)

Manny, Diego, and Sid’s brood expands to accommodate Ellie along with her half-brothers, Crash and Eddie.

Ellie

Voiced by Queen Latifah

“Me? Don’t be ridiculous! I’m not a mammoth, I’m a possum.”

Ellie is Manny’s about-to-be better half, and is actually a mammoth who thinks of herself to be part-possum. She precariously hangs upside down by her tail, perched on a branch, and never for a moment considers it to be an aberration.

Easygoing and feisty, she brings in the much-needed spark in Manny’s humdrum existence.

Trivia

The flashback in the movie was originally going to focus on Manny’s conflict with his first family. However, Queen Latifah suggested the idea of using the flashback to center on Ellie’s origins.

Eddie

Voiced by Josh Peck

“Sometimes, I wet my bed!”

Crash

Voiced by Seann William Scott

“That’s alright, sometimes I wet your bed!”

Crash and Eddie are Ellie’s possum half-brothers. Insanely stupid, these two are complete whack-jobs. That said, they love their sister Ellie with all their heart and indulge in all kinds of silly adventures, much to her amusem*nt.

Trivia

Despite being identical twins, there are subtle differences in their appearance―Crash has blue eyes and a flatter nose with ridges, whereas Eddie has brown eyes and a pointier nose with a brown stripe.

Ice Age: Dawn of the Dinosaurs (2009)

This time, the Herd avails the services of Buck, the weasel to rescue Sid who wanders off with a female T-rex.

Buck

Voiced by Simon Pegg

“The Buck stops here!”

Buck is the daredevil weasel with a curious appearance―he wears a leafy eye patch to conceal his missing eye, and has scars marring his face.

He’s known to be quite loony otherwise, but tends to shine when battling dinosaurs.

Trivia

The name ‘Buck’ is short for Buckminister and long for Buh.

Ice Age: Continental Drift (2012)

The Herd heads to the high seas to reunite with Manny’s family. But they have to battle the ferocious Captain Gutt and his cronies before they sail to safety.

Captain Gutt

Voiced by Peter Dinklage

“In my ocean: what a terrible turn of events. I love a terrible turn of events!”

Captain Gutt is the main antagonist of Continental Drift. He’s a ruthless pirate of the high seas, and is named so because of his long, sharpened fingernails that he uses to “gut” his enemies with.

Trivia

The character of Captain Gutt was originally slated to be a bear, but the designers concluded that a primate would be more flexible in comparison, and made the switch. Also, Jeremy Renner was the first choice to voice the character, but was replaced by Peter Dinklage, owing to the former’s scheduling conflicts.

Granny

Voiced by Wanda Sykes

“I’ll bury y’all and dance on your grave!”

Granny is actually Sid’s eccentric granny, but becomes the de facto savior of the herd from the pirates, thanks to her “invisible” friend, Precious, the whale.

Trivia

Granny is voiced by Wanda Sykes, one of the finest stand-up comediennes belonging to the current lot.

Shira

Voiced by Jennifer Lopez

“Don’t, call me Kitty.”

Shira is the gorgeous, firebrand saber-toothed feline, who is a part of Captain Gutt’s gang of pirates. She initially shares a love-hate equation with Diego, but finally goes on to learn that a loving family is all you need to be happy, thus, becoming a part of The Herd.

Trivia

As Diego’s love interest, Shira is a saber-toothed cat, but unlike him, she is a snow leopard.

Peaches

Voiced by Keke Palmer

“Bad enough? There’s nothing bad about being part of my family. I “like” hanging by my tail and if you geniuses are normal, the species is going to end up extinct!”

Manny and Ellie’s daughter, Peaches is all grownup in this film. She is shown to have inherited her mother’s stubborn nature and her uncles’ (Crash and Eddie) thirst for adventure.

With her faithful pal Louis (voiced by Josh Gad) by her side, she learns the true meaning of what it means to be a part of a loving family.

Trivia

Peaches was born at the end of the third installment Dawn of the Dinosaurs. She was named so by her parents as she was “sweet, round, and fuzzy.”

Ethan

Voiced by Drake

“Yo, that was insane!”

Ethan is the heartthrob among mammoth teens and is fancied by Peaches. She, however, goes on to see him for the moron he is after he unduly risks his life, along with the lives of his friends.

Trivia

The theme song ‘We are Family’ was sung by Drake, along with other cast members including Jennifer Lopez, Queen Latifah, Keke Palmer, Nicki Minaj, Heather Morris, and Ester Dean.
